button按钮禁止点击
时间: 2023-07-05 11:33:43 浏览: 67
要禁止一个按钮的点击,你可以使用JavaScript来实现。具体的步骤如下:
1. 获取到需要禁止点击的按钮元素,可以通过ID、class等方式获取。
2. 使用JavaScript的setAttribute()方法将按钮的disabled属性设置为true,这样就可以禁止按钮的点击了。代码如下:
```
var btn = document.getElementById("myButton");
btn.setAttribute("disabled", true);
```
3. 如果需要启用按钮的点击,可以将disabled属性设置为false,代码如下:
```
btn.setAttribute("disabled", false);
```
这样就可以通过JavaScript来禁止或启用按钮的点击了。
相关问题
按钮禁止点击属性
按钮禁止点击可以通过设置disabled属性来实现。在HTML中,可以在按钮标签中添加disabled属性来禁用按钮,例如:
```
<button disabled>禁用按钮</button>
```
在JavaScript中,也可以通过代码来控制按钮的disabled属性,例如:
```
var button = document.getElementById("myButton");
button.disabled = true; // 禁用按钮
button.disabled = false; // 启用按钮
```
需要注意的是,禁用按钮后,用户将无法点击它,同时按钮的样式也会发生变化,变成灰色并且无法获取焦点。
react组件中的button按钮怎么控制禁止点击
在React组件中,你可以使用state来控制按钮是否可以点击。具体的步骤如下:
1. 在组件的constructor中初始化state,添加一个名为disabled的状态,初始值为false,表示按钮可以点击。
```
constructor(props) {
super(props);
this.state = {
disabled: false
};
}
```
2. 在按钮的onClick事件处理函数中,通过setState方法更新disabled状态,将其设置为true,即禁止按钮点击。
```
handleClick = () => {
this.setState({
disabled: true
});
}
```
3. 在按钮的disabled属性中,使用state中的disabled状态来控制是否禁止点击。
```
<button onClick={this.handleClick} disabled={this.state.disabled}>点击我</button>
```
这样就可以通过React的state来控制按钮是否可以点击了。如果需要启用按钮的点击,只需要将disabled状态设置为false即可。